April 15, 2014 Power Struggle Within the Characters and Setting in Sonnys Blues As the setting in Sonnys Blues takes place in Harlem it sets up a good understanding of the background of the characters. The young man is has to go through the struggles of going through jail making him look like hes a bad guy. In reality hes just trying to become a musician. Sonnys brother doesnt want him to go back to his old ways by bringing him back to Harlem. However, the setting helps reveal this being in Harlem where the jazz scene thrives but also does the drug trafficking. Sonnys brother has no faith in him neither his family. However when Sonny takes his brother to one of his shows, he realizes he is in Sonnys world now and understands where his music is coming from. The power of Marxist criticism highlights the power struggle of the main characters and the world in which they live. As Joseph Flibbert has pointed out, you can try and escape where youre raised from or the blues but it can be extremely hard and take a lot of time, but it is possible. Sonny in his younger days roamed the streets on dope and ended up in prison. Them wanting to leave their old ways they both went to the military. Sonnys brother believes with his high college education and job as a teacher it will eliminate these blues. Sonnys escape is him playing music. His true passion is playing jazz music, piano in particular. Sonny wasnt using dope as an escape to leave these blues but was using it as more as a drug to bear the suffering of seeing and hearing reality.
